The Best Part Of Fremantle While Having Your Engagement Shoot
Fremantle is certainly a favoured spot for engagement photos. As a result, the most scenic areas, often with old buildings, are filled with people and cars. You might wonder how we managed to keep these distractions out of Ellie and Marty’s shoot. I’ll tell you more about that soon.
Ellie and Marty wanted their photos to have a classic feel with old buildings, but they also wanted a fun twist to make lasting memories. So, they showed up in a Cadillac convertible, which added a playful element to their session.
The charm of Fremantle has so much to offer; you can capture various themes in one place:
Old Buildings – Offer a classic, romantic feel
Cafes – Provide a warm, everyday vibe
Shorelines – Give a laid-back, informal mood
Ellie and Marty picked the old buildings for a classic, stylish look, made more fun by the convertible.
